Two-component model for the deuteron electromagnetic structure
Abstract
We suggest a simple phenomenological parametrization for all three deuteron electromagnetic form factors, and show that a good fit on the available data, with a minimal number of parameters, can be obtained. The present description of the deuteron electromagnetic structure is based on two components with different radii, one corresponding to two nucleons separated by $\simeq $2 fm, and a standard isoscalar contribution, saturated by $ω$ and $ϕ$ mesons, only.
